Return All Fields After sqlb Insert

💡 原文英文,约200词,阅读约需1分钟。
📝

内容提要

这篇文章介绍了一个名为Category的结构体,包含了id、name、icon等属性。还介绍了一个create函数,用于创建Category对象,并将其插入数据库中。函数中使用了一些库和方法来实现相关功能。

🎯

关键要点

  • 介绍了一个名为Category的结构体,包含id、name、icon等属性。

  • Category结构体还包含poster、z_key、z_order、created_at、updated_at、description、status和z_extra等属性。

  • 定义了一个create函数,用于创建Category对象并插入数据库。

  • create函数使用了sqlb库来构建插入语句,并返回Category的相关字段。

  • 函数处理插入结果,返回创建成功或失败的状态和信息。

延伸问答

Category结构体包含哪些属性?

Category结构体包含id、name、icon、poster、z_key、z_order、created_at、updated_at、description、status和z_extra等属性。

create函数的主要功能是什么?

create函数用于创建Category对象并将其插入数据库中。

如何处理create函数的插入结果?

create函数处理插入结果时,如果成功返回创建的Category数据,失败则返回错误信息。

create函数使用了哪些库?

create函数使用了sqlb库来构建插入语句。

create函数如何返回Category的相关字段?

create函数通过调用sqlb库的returning方法来返回Category的相关字段。

如果create函数插入失败,会返回什么?

如果插入失败,create函数会返回状态码为BAD_REQUEST的错误信息。

➡️

继续阅读